Lawrence E. Ornell is a judge of the Superior Court of Sonoma County in California. He was appointed by Governor Jerry Brown on December 27, 2013 for a term that expires in 2019. He replaced retired judge Mark Tansil.[1]
Education
Ornell received his undergraduate degree from California State University, Sacramento and his J.D. from the Empire College School of Law.[1]
Career
- 2013-2019: Judge, Superior Court of Sonoma County
- 2004-2013: Commissioner, Superior Court of Sonoma County
- 1993-2004: Deputy district attorney, Sonoma County
- 1991-1993: Attorney in private practice[1]
